ATLANTA, Feb. 16 /PRNewswire/ -- Multicast Media Technologies, Inc., a market leader in live event webcasts, announced today that it delivered 51,674 live events over the Internet in 2009. To enable clients to maximize the value of their videos beyond the initial event broadcast, Multicast is expanding its live offerings with the addition of Simulated Live broadcasts to its comprehensive, hosted Multicast Media Suite solution.
Simulated Live broadcasts are the delivery of prerecorded videos and associated presentation aids, such as synchronized slide presentations, as a scheduled broadcast. Organizations can easily and affordably increase the impact of their live event, reach more people, build a community experience and add additional monetization opportunities. Just as if the broadcast were live, organizations can engage their audience and deliver a high-quality viewing experience that enables viewers to interact with each other in real-time.
Simulated Live broadcasts also can be scheduled for the same relative time around the globe. For example, corporate updates could be delivered at the start of the workday, or consumer updates could be delivered after business hours.

Schwartz continued, "Live Internet and iPhone broadcasting is a rapidly growing part of our business. In the fourth quarter of 2009, we delivered 31% more live events than in the first quarter of the year. During the course of the year, we delivered live Internet events for a diverse set of clients, including Dave Ramsey's Town Hall for Hope broadcast, which was seen by more than 1.4 million viewers; the very successful Maximum Impact Leadership event, which featured an all-star list of speakers including John Maxwell, Tony Blair and Jack Nicklaus; and many of the world's leading corporations including Delta Airlines, FedEx, Infor and Turner Broadcasting."
